However, little is known about the extent to which PCPs share these … Webb1 maj 2024 · The 21st Century Cures Act (hereinafter the “Cures Act”) was enacted on December 13, 2016, to accelerate the discovery, development, and delivery of 21st century cures, and for other purposes. The Cures Act, Pub. L. 114-255 , included Title IV—Delivery, which amended portions of the HITECH Act (Title XIII of Division A of Pub. L. 111-5 ) by …

Medical personnel rarely learn effective non-clinical procedures for... WebbThe Cures Act allocates funding to NIH over each of the next 10 years, for a total of $4.8 billion. However, funding must be appropriated each year. The Act also required the NIH Director to submit an Innovation Fund work plan to Congress.
